1. MIT
The Massachusetts Institute of Technology was founded in 1861 as a private research institute. The MIT Department of Economics offers inaugural master's program- Master's in Data, Economics, and Development Policy. It is also the first MIT program to only be offered in a hybrid (online/residential) format.

2. Stanford University
A Joint Degree program offered by the Department of Economics and the Stanford Law School allows students to earn a degree, along with an M.A. in Economics or a J.D. along with a Ph.D. in Economics. Additionally, there are a number of condensed legal programs available to graduate students in economics that expose students to the law but don't culminate in a J.D. rather than a master's degree.

3. Columbia University
Columbia University, founded in 1754 by George II of Great Britain, is a private research university Students who want to advance their understanding of economic theory and its applications or prepare themselves for employment in the field of economics can enroll in the Master of Arts program at the Department of Economics at Columbia. The curriculum gives students the opportunity to extend their education through elective courses provided by the department.

4. University of Michigan
The University of Michigan, one of the best universities for masters in economics in USA, was founded in 1817. The Master's degree in Applied Economics is a policy-oriented curriculum that places a strong emphasis on using economic principles and techniques to solve real-world issues that arise in a range of sectors. Typically, it takes students in this program 1.5 years to finish their work.

5. Boston University
Boston University, based in Boston, Massachusetts, is a private global research institute. The MA in Economics provides its graduates with the in-depth understanding and quantitative abilities necessary for an economic analyst in the commercial world, consultancy industry, a central bank, or government. The elective course, is taught by our own research experts, fostering quantitative abilities and specialized knowledge in almost all of the key fields of economics.
